Praveen P Nair IAS has been appointed as Joint Secretary in the Ministry of Ports, Shipping & Waterways, marking an important milestone in his administrative career. A seasoned officer of the Indian Administrative Service, he is known for his efficiency, policy expertise, and strong governance track record.
Praveen P Nair IAS brings with him vast experience in public administration, having served in multiple key positions at both the state and central levels. His appointment comes at a time when India is actively focusing on enhancing its maritime infrastructure, port connectivity, and logistics efficiency under various flagship initiatives.
As Joint Secretary in the Ministry of Ports, Shipping & Waterways, Praveen P Nair IAS will play a crucial role in policy formulation, implementation of maritime projects, and coordination with various stakeholders. The ministry is responsible for the development and regulation of ports, shipping, and inland waterways, which are vital to India’s trade and economic growth.
